DESCRIPTION
The ln05jaof filter is used to filter text data for the Japanese
DEClaser 2300 printer. The filter handles the device dependencies of
the printer and performs accounting functions. At print job completion
times, accounting records are written to the file specified by the af
field in the /etc/printcap file.
The ln05jaof filter can handle plain text files and files preprocessed
by nroff. The filter translates nroff control sequences for underlin‐
ing, superscripting, and subscripting into the proper control sequences
for the DEClaser 2300 printer.
The ln05jaof filter can be the specified filter in both the of and the
if fields in the /etc/printcap file. For a description of these fields,
see printcap(4).
The DEClaser 2300 printer can be configured to use the software on-
demand loading (SoftODL) mechanism to print user-defined characters
(UDCs). See i18n_printing(5) for a description of SoftODL.
To enable SoftODL printing, set the ys field in /etc/printcap to 256.
You can also set the default SoftODL database, style, and size by using
the odldb and odlstyle options of the ya field. If you specify a value
for the yt field, use fifo. For more information on these fields and
associated options, refer to printcap(4).

ERRORS
The lf field (default value is /dev/null) in the /etc/printcap file
specifies the name of the error log.
